Most retail traders mistakenly believe the Ichimoku system was created by a single man, Goichi Hosoda (who published under the pen name Ichimoku Sanjin). While Hosoda was the originator, he was a journalist, not a mathematician or a broker. He spent decades (pre-WWII through the 1960s) developing the concept.
Sasaki explains why Hosoda chose the 9, 26, and 52 periods based on a Japanese trading year (6-day week, 4-week month, 1-quarter). But more importantly, Sasaki introduces alternative settings for different asset classes: ichimoku kinko studies hidenobu sasaki pdf verified
